For those unable to attend,  you can still contribute to our score: The rules allow local contacts on 2 metres, 10 metres and 160 metres. Multiple contacts can be made on 2 metres every two hours. Suggest we use the calling frequency 146.500 (simplex), +/-, if you'd like to add your two-bob's worth. Contacts on 160m are worth double points, as are contacts made between 0100 and 0600.

We can also use the Paddington repeater for liason if home stations would like to "spot" possible QSOs on other bands.
